Tsunoda Says He Is 'Pissed Off' After Red Bull Ends His 2026 Race Role

He will serve as Red Bull's test and reserve driver in 2026 following the post-Qatar decision to elevate Isack Hadjar to the race seat.

  • Tsunoda said Helmut Marko told him privately after the Lusail race that he would not be racing next year.
  • Red Bull confirmed Isack Hadjar will step up to the senior team for 2026, with Arvid Lindblad joining Racing Bulls.
  • Tsunoda cited contract restrictions that limited talks with other teams despite outside interest in a 2026 drive.
  • Promoted to Red Bull two races into 2025, he scored 30 points across 21 starts while Max Verstappen set the team benchmark.
  • He expressed regret about leaving the Racing Bulls car he helped develop and plans to use 2026 to learn from a different perspective while staying ready for opportunities.
